Transaction 5676aad0bc7029630c74b6251e58cb104e4ee09ebf86c43b65faa67bed27217e
1 Input
2 Outputs
- 5676aad0bc7029630c74b6251e58cb104e4ee09ebf86c43b65faa67bed27217e:0
- 5676aad0bc7029630c74b6251e58cb104e4ee09ebf86c43b65faa67bed27217e:1
value 100000000
address 1PDuvyL8E1VL3Chu4dzdERf2Dp1w34XTc1
value 710994880
address 1FL6MeMM2ftnRDAmNHHeDFAY5kVHqQNXko